The last two remaining groups that still required appointments for vaccination will be able to do away with that process.
Starting Thursday, February 3rd children between 5 and 11 can get the second dose at the CLE Coliseum while anyone 18 years and older can receive their booster.
Officials also unveiled Wednesday that with the supply of the adult Pfizer vaccine (Comirnaty) improving in Ontario, anyone 30 years and older can receive it if they choose.
Walk-in appointments will be available during the following hours:
Mondays, Wednesdays and Fridays from 9: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m.
Tuesdays and Thursdays from 11:30 a.m. to 6:30 p.m.
Appointments remain an option for anyone who prefers them and can be booked through the provincial booking system or by calling 1-833-943-3900.
